Output 66771181e515929232d4910ab70a0a02b68722ebca00e2f8e69bcc488c87c18c:0

value
5995560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9446ca4cc2cf2756de24a3e8a02c696bde1c26a OP_EQUAL
address
3QR29X5jb3ef8bJpub8qmDjhucypQPKtBJ
transaction
66771181e515929232d4910ab70a0a02b68722ebca00e2f8e69bcc488c87c18c
spent
true